在现代社会中,信息安全已经成为一个至关重要的领域。无论是个人隐私保护还是企业商业机密的安全,都离不开密码学的支持。那么,密码学的目的是什么呢?
简单来说,密码学的核心目标是确保信息的保密性、完整性和可用性。具体而言,它通过一系列复杂的算法和技术手段,为数据提供安全防护,使其免受未授权访问和恶意篡改的影响。
一、保障信息的保密性
保密性是密码学最基本的功能之一。通过加密技术,敏感信息可以在传输过程中被转化为不可读的形式,只有拥有正确解密密钥的人才能还原其原始内容。例如,在网络通信中,用户登录时输入的密码通常会被加密处理后再发送给服务器,从而防止黑客截获并窃取用户的个人信息。
二、维护信息的完整性
除了保护信息不被泄露外,密码学还致力于防止信息在传输过程中遭到篡改。数字签名技术就是实现这一目的的有效工具。当发送方使用私钥对消息进行签名后,接收方可以利用公钥验证该签名的真实性,以此确认收到的消息确实来自发送方且未被修改过。
三、增强系统的可用性
虽然听起来有些矛盾,但事实上,良好的密码学设计同样能够提高系统整体的可用性。合理配置加密强度与性能之间的平衡点,使得即使面对高强度攻击也能保持服务正常运行,这对于构建稳定可靠的信息基础设施至关重要。
总之,密码学不仅是一项技术,更是一种思维方式——它教会我们如何以科学的态度对待风险,并采取适当措施加以应对。随着科技的发展和社会需求的变化,未来密码学还将继续演进,为我们创造更加安全便捷的生活环境!